How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Paw Paw?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Paw Paw Studio Apartments | $1,666 | $1,650 | $1,700 |
| Paw Paw 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,556 | $500 | $2,150 |
| Paw Paw 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,577 | $550 | $2,846 |
| Paw Paw 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,887 | $815 | $3,575 |
| Paw Paw 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,660 | $2,099 | $3,900 |
